Past simple or present perfect ? I have just returned from a walk with my dog and it is still morning, I am describing what has just happened should I say It has taken me so long to walk my dog out this morning because of the rain Or It took me so long ? Thanks a lot

It's a completed action and you specified the time so I'd probably go with 'took'. I mean if you had literally just walked in the door and you didn't specify the time, I might use 'has taken'. As for walking the dog I would say 'to take my dog out', or 'to take my dog for a walk' or 'to walk my dog' (to avoid repetition of 'take' maybe the last of these would be best) rather than 'walk my dog out' which doesn't really work. I'd also say 'the dog' rather than 'my dog'.
